serve a purpose
verb phrase
Meaning
Perform a useful function or fulfill a specific need within a situation.
Examples
- This small tool serves a purpose in tight spaces where larger equipment cannot reach.
- Every department in the company must serve a purpose to justify its budget.
Pronunciation: /sɜːrv ə ˈpɜːrpəs/
How to Use serve a purpose
- serve a purpose (idiom)
- to be useful — "Does this old software still serve a purpose?"
- serve the purpose of (idiom)
- to act as a substitute for something else — "This box can serve the purpose of a chair until we buy more."
